Book Synopsis



El nuevo e intrigante libro del maestro del thriller médico.

La pareja de médicos forenses formada por Laurie Montgomery y Jack Stapleton se enfrenta a un peligroso desafío.

Cuando la autopsia de un hombre aparentemente víctima de suicidio plantea más preguntas que respuestas, Laurie Montgomery, la médica forense jefa de la ciudad de Nueva York, junto con Ryan Sullivan, el joven médico en prácticas en su departamento, deciden comparar e investigar una serie de suicidios recientes cuyas autopsias habían revelado señales de alerta y posibles indicios criminales.

Sus investigaciones les conducirán a una compañía de diagnóstico de cáncer que promueve una innovadora y fraudulenta tecnología de detección de la enfermedad, y se verán arrastrados a una conspiración que pondrá en peligro sus vidas.

ENGLISH DESCRIPTION

In this fast-paced medical mystery-thriller from New York Times bestselling author Robin Cook, fan favorites Jack and Laurie must determine the manner of death after a pathology resident's suspicious suicide.

Due to Jack Stapleton's ongoing recovery from his near-death confrontation with a serial killer, his wife, Laurie Montgomery, the NYC chief medical examiner, is carrying the load both at work and at home. When she insists an underperforming pathology resident named Ryan Sullivan assist her on a suicide autopsy, Laurie unknowingly provokes an emotional storm in the trainee.

So, when Ryan himself appears on the medical examiner's table days later, an apparent death by suicide, Laurie's guilt compels her to try to understand why. Jack's autopsy on the resident opens the disturbing possibility that the manner of death wasn't suicide but instead a staged homicide. But staged by whom?

Laurie ignores her own professional rules and responsibilities to investigate personally who might want Ryan dead...and for what reason. Thus begins a dangerous inquiry into a fraudulent but highly lucrative cancer diagnostics company, which might just cost Laurie her life.

About the Author



El doctor y escritor Robin Cook está considerado el creador del thriller médico y sigue siendo el novelista más importante del género. Es autor de más de treinta libros, todos grandes éxitos internacionales y traducidos a cuarenta idiomas. En sus novelas explora la implicación ética de los más actuales desarrollos médicos y biotécnicos. Cook no solo sabe cómo entretener a sus lectores, sino que a la vez alerta de cómo los adelantos de la medicina están en manos de grandes empresas cuya prioridad es siempre sacar el máximo beneficio. Muchas de sus novelas se han convertido en películas.

Aparte de escribir, sus intereses son la arquitectura, el diseño de interiores, la restauración y el deporte. Actualmente vive entre Florida y New Hampshire.
